Background. Measuring religious attitudes in Islamic Religious Education has its own challenges. To understand the level of students' attitudes towards religious material, appropriate and relevant instruments are needed.

Purpose. This study aims to identify and evaluate the types of attitude scales used in Islamic religious education and to provide recommendations for their use in Islamic religious education.

Method. This article was compiled using a library research method. In data collection, sorting and selection were carried out on the concepts and definitions found. The analysis method used involves two main approaches, namely deductive and inductive. The deductive approach is used by drawing conclusions from general facts that have been known to produce more specific conclusions. The inductive approach is applied to draw conclusions from concrete phenomena or situations towards a more abstract understanding.

Results. The results of the study of the types of attitude scales are the Likert scale, Guttman scale, semantic differential, and rating scale.

Conclusion. The use of various types of measurement scales provides an effective tool for measuring students' attitudes, perceptions, and understanding of religious teachings. This study provides a basis for developing more effective and accurate instruments to improve the quality of Islamic Religious Education learning at various levels of education.
